The therapeutic activity of two new benzofuran-imidazoles, IM/B/4-62 and IM/B/4-66, formulated as 1% cream, has been evaluated against Candida albicans and Trichophyton mentagrophytes by inducing experimental vaginal candidosis in female rats and dermatophytosis in female guinea pigs. Results of the treatment were compared with those obtained by the same therapeutic regimen carried out with bifonazole. IM/B/4-66 proved to possess superior antimycotic activity to that of IM/B/4-62 and similar to that of bifonazole in both infections. Nmaley vaginal candidosis was cured in all the treated in animals at 6 days post-inoculation and skin lesions were healed in 9 of 10 animals at 15 days after infection, with negative cultures from all the infected sites.
